    Different types of player - and they both offer the team something, but need to be more consistent. Giroud had a decent enough first season, scored 11 and helped link up play and set up chances, he's a good team player. Gervinho is more of an individual flair type player and can dribble and score, but doesn't do it often enough. He's 27 now too, so I'm not sure we can expect much more from him. Decent impact sub.

    Giroud offers more to the team though and through the course of the season would be a more effective player.
